The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of Theophilus Taylor, born in 1824 in Hereford, Herefordshire, consisted of 6 members. Theophilus was the head of the household, married to Louisa Taylor, born in 1828 in Gloucester, Gloucestershire, England. They had 2 children; Arthur W (born 1868 in -) and Ellen B (born 1870 in -).
During the period, also present in the household were Theophilus's Dom Servant, Ellen M T (born 1857 in Chatham, Kent, England) and Theophilus's Dom Servant, Isabella (born 1863 in City of London, Middlesex, England).
